Informatica Developer Resume
MassachusettS
SUMMARY:
- 8+ years in the Information Technology and wide range of experience in Software development, Data Integration, Unit testing with tools Informatica Power Center, Informatica Data Quality (IDQ)
- Expertise in ETL (Extraction, Transformation and Loading) of data from various sources into EDW, ODS and Data marts using Data Integration tool Informatica Power Center.
- Expertise on Informatica Mappings, Mapplets, Sessions, Workflows and Worklets for data loads.
- Hands on experience in Performance tuning mappings, identifying and resolving performance bottlenecks in various levels like sources, targets, mappings and sessions.
- Extensive experience in developing Stored Procedures, Functions, Triggers, Views, Cursors, Packages, Exceptions, Joins, Sub Queries and Set Operators.
- Worked on exception handling mappings for DataQuality, DataProfiling, Data Cleansing and Data Validation and Address Doctor .
- Good knowledge of Informatica Data Quality transformations like Address validator, Parser, Labeler, Match, Exception, Association, Standardizer and other significant transformations
- Hands on experience on Migration Projects from Netezza to Exadata, changing source DB’s and Target DB’s.
- Expertise in design and configuration of landing tables, staging tables, base objects, hierarchies, foreign - key relationships, lookups, query groups, queries/custom queries and packages.
- Worked on Slowly Changing Dimensions - Type 1, Type 2 and Type 3 in different mappings as per the Business Requirements.
- Excellent exposure to Technical documentation like Mapping Specs, Technical Specification Documents / Release Plans / Unit Test plans etc. as per the Client requirements.
- Possess very good experience working in Agile methodology in fast paced environment handling sprints and coordinating with multiple teams as needed.
- Possesses unique combination of business and technical acumen, strong leadership and people skills, analytical, negotiation and problem-solving abilities.
TECHNICAL SKILLS:
Data Warehousing Tools: Informatica Power Center 9.x/8.x, Informatica Data Quality (IDQ)V9.x, Informatica Master Data Management V9. x.
Languages: C, SQL, PL/SQL, CORE JAVA
Databases: Oracle 11i/10g/9.x, Microsoft SQL ServerV 2014/2012/2008, Nexus
Development Tools: Toad, SQL Developer, SQL* Plus
Scheduling Tools: Autosys / Tidal / Control- M
Configuration Tools: Team Foundation Server 2010, VSS, Quality Centre
PROFESSIONAL EXPERIENCE:
Confidential, Massachusetts
Informatica Developer
Environment: Informatica Power Center 9.5.1, Oracle, PL/SQLAutosys, MS-Office, UNIX OS
Responsibilities:
- Followed Agile Methodology, involved in daily scrum meetings of a sprint.
- Extracted data from different Government Reporting Data Stores GRDS, CMS, CWDS -Crown-Web data store system to Staging Area -> Dev and loaded the data to the target database by ETL process using Informatica Power Center.
- Utilized of Informatica IDQ to complete initial data profiling and matching/removing duplicate data.
- Created STTM’s (Source to Target mapping documents) to outline data flow from sources to targets.
- Applied Database Tuning and Optimization, Normalization in the new database design.
- Parsed high-level design specification to simple ETL coding and mapping standards.
- Involved in Performance tuning Confidential source, target, mappings, sessions, and system levels.
- Used various transformations like Filter, Expression, Sequence Generator, Update Strategy, Joiner, Stored Procedure, and Union to develop robust mappings in the Informatica Designer.
- Developed complex mappings in Informatica to load the data from various sources.
- Extensively used workflow variables, mapping parameters and mapping variables.
- Worked on creating and extracting data into Stage/Landing, Dimensions, Facts tables.
- Created Test cases for the mappings developed and then created integration Testing Document.
Confidential, Worcester, Massachusetts
Informatica Developer
Environment: Informatica IDQ, Informatica Power Center, Oracle, PL/SQLAutosys, MS-Office, UNIX OS
Responsibilities:
- Worked with Systems Analysts to prepare detailed specs from which programs was written.
- Worked on the Workflows, sessions and Informatica mappings.
- Designing and developing Informatica mappings including Type-I, Type-II, Type-III slowly changing dimensions (SCD).
- Created Source to Target mappings.
- Designed, developed, implemented and maintained Informatica PowerCenter and IDQ application for matching and merging process.
- Integrated Informatica applications as Mapplets within PowerCenter Mappings.
- Completed system testing utilizing toolsets of Mercury quality center.
- Utilized of Informatica IDQ to complete initial data profiling and matching/removing duplicate data.
- Designed, coded, tested, debug and documented as per the Business requirements.
- Performance tuning is performed Confidential the Mapping level as well as the Database level to increase the data throughput.
- Written all the Technical Specification documents related to the multiple releases and changes as per the new releases.
- Performed Unit Testing for the code developed. Conducted Systems Integration Testing (SIT) along with the BSA team.
Confidential, New York, NY
Informatica/ IDQ Developer
Environment: Informatica IDQ 9.0.1, Informatica PowerCenter 9.x, Oracle, PL/SQLTidal scheduling tool, MS-Office, Unix OS
Responsibilities:
- Created Mappings using transformation like Expression, Standardizer, Decision transformation, Sequence Generator etc.
- Worked with Address Doctor for quality check of addresses.
- Creation of WSDL and web Service consumer transformation
- Used Labeler transformation (Token based and Parser based) extensively.
- Created Services like Model Repository service, Integration service, Content Management Service
Confidential, Bothell, Washington, DC.
Informatica Developer
Technology: Informatica Power Centre 8.6, Netezza, Oracle, Nexus Query Chameleon, UNIX, SAP Business Objects BI Platform, Toad.
Responsibilities:
- Extensively used ETL methodologies for supporting data extraction, transformation and
- Loading process, in a corporate-wide-ETL solution using Informatica Power Center.
- Tuned the performance of mappings by following Informatica best practices and also applied several methods to get best performance by decreasing the run time of workflows.
- Continuous Production support for eDM (e-commerce Datamart) from 3 data center’s Allen(Texas), Lynnwood(WA), Bothell(WA) that is heavily used to track various data including clickstream, order, fulfillment and subscriber metrics for att.com.
- Used Informatica PowerCenter, Netezza, SAP Business Intelligence (BI) tools and Reporting Tools (Business Objects) for day to day tasks.
- Perform a weekly BI 8-Clustered Production Servers Reboot.
- (Restarting - Apache/Tomcat and Web Intelligence services.)
- Recover ETL-Go jobs failures like Character width exceeded, constraint violation, null values, pg atio, and spool space issues within the SLA time given.
- Monitor and respond to requests for assistance of various kinds. Work with users, Project Managers, and ETL developers to design and implement new subject areas in the appropriate tool.
- Monitor Netezza Server Administrator to give best performance during data loading time by Killing/Aborting the long running queries.
- Changing priorities of ad-hoc queries running in Netezza on client request using Stored procedures.
- Work independently and as a part of a team, Onsite-Offshore with clients, building a relationship with and interacting with client team members to ensure project success.
- Vertica POC Testing: Involved in POC testing on Vertica v/s Netezza to migrate from Netezza to Vertica. Done Sequential, concurrent testing in BO.
Confidentia, Bothell, Washington DC.
Informatica Developer / Production Support Analyst
Environment: Informatica8.6, Toad, Oracle, UNIX, Windows.
Responsibilities:
- Job responsibilities include Using Informatica Power Center, Unix, Reporting Tools (Business Objects)
- Zodiac Testing: Validating the data from DEV and PROD systems coming from different data centers.
- Supporting daily loads and work with business users to handle rejected data.
- To be successful, a critical role on the team by acting not only as a Support Engineer but also as a liaison with business clients and technical team members.
- Used SQL tools like TOAD and SQL Developer for developing and executing the SQL queries to understand data flow.
- Monitor and respond to requests for assistance of various kinds. Work with users, SME’s and ETL developers to design and implement new subject areas in the appropriate tool.
- Monitoring and validating Webtrends profiles where all the Clickstream data is processed and loaded in 39 profiles which runs 4 cycles/day.
- Scheduling shell scripts using cron-jobscheduling.
- Checking the Netezza SPU’s and SPA’s health and killing the hung queries.
Confidential, Washington DC.
Informatica Developer
Environment: Informatica8.6, Toad, Oracle, UNIX, Windows.
- Worked on Informatica client tools like Source Analyzer, Warehouse Designer, Mapping Designer, Mapplet Designer and Transformations Developer.
- Involved in developing multidimensional data modeling using star schema and snow flake schema.
- Used Informatica to extract and load data from Oracle database and flat files to Oracle tables.
- Created various mappings using Designer which include Expression, Router, Aggregator, Stored Procedure, Update strategy and Look-up Transformations.
- Created Mapplets using Mapplet Designer to reuse in different mappings.
- Created FTP connections, database connections for the sources and targets.
- Created and Monitored Sessions using Session Manager.
- Handled performance tuning by checking bottlenecks also created partitions, SQL override in Source qualifier.
- Wrote stored procedures, functions and triggers using Oracle PL/SQL.
- Designed the reports and Universes as per the requirements
